London, June 15: While Paris Hilton refused to join Christiano Ronaldo in Vegas and flew off to Dubai, the love-struck footballer is all set for a long-distance fling with the hotel heiress.
The multimillionaire socialite headed off to record a TV series, leaving the midfielder to party with a bevy of girls.
Although Ronldo was pictured with a host of beauties in Vegas, he has insisted that he will stay faithful to Paris.
And this is despite his mum refusing to approve the relationship, reveal his pals.
"He`s really taken by Paris, it could be something big," the Daily Star quoted a source close to Ronaldo as saying.
"She`s got to go to Dubai with work, and that`s probably a good thing to be honest. It will test how serious they are about each other.
"There`s a feeling that neither needs the other one`s money, which is a breath of fresh air for the pair of them - they`re normally on the lookout for gold-diggers.
"They`ve pledged to keep in touch, and have been texting each other all the time.
"Fortunately Paris knows all about the paparazzi, so she understands that every time Cristiano is pictured with another girl, he`s not being unfaithful. It will be very interesting to see how it all pans out," the source added.
The pair hooked up last Wednesday (June 10) after the news of Ronaldo`s world-record 80million-pound move to Real Madrid first broke, and they spent a second night together 24 hours later.
Paris reportedly told her pals that she thought Ronaldo was "red hot" and couldn`t wait to get to grips with him again soon.
Meanwhile, he continued partying in Las Vegas, heading to XS nightclub with his entourage of pals and relatives.
But onlookers have said that even though the player enjoyed drinking and dancing with the girls, he remains faithful to Paris.
Among Ronaldo`s relatives in Vegas is his mother Dolores Averio, 57, who flew out late last week to help him celebrate his world record transfer move, which is almost certain to go through later this month.
However, sources have revealed that she disapproves of Paris, who, in her opinion, is not good enough for her boy.
A friend said: "She`s not every mother`s ideal daughter-in-law. She`s not too happy with Cristiano falling for her, but she knows he`s a grown man so will let him make his own mistakes."
